摘要
Optical microresonant mode switching in a hexagonal GaN microdisk, which acts as a whispering gallery mode (WGM) and quasi-WGM (QWGM), has been demonstrated by a change in the condition of the reflection surface under a room temperature photoluminescence (RT-PL) measurement. It has been confirmed that only the WGM in the microdisk, which uses all side walls of a microdisk as the reflection surface, was strongly affected by attaching another microdisk on a side wall. The result indicates that the WGM can be controlled independently by external factors.
